## Deployment

GateTally runs as a single binary per turnstile bank. Build with `make release`, copy to the edge box, restart the service. Each Ashmere Stadium bank needs its own node id; counts sync to the Tallyhub aggregator every 10s. Do not reuse ids across gates or totals double. Set the environment before first start using the values below.

service settings:
[eliix]
port = 7000
region = central-4
host = eliix.crelvocorp.local
team = fraael
timeout_ms = 3000
retries = 4

- [ ] **Step 7: Breaker override escrow.** After sealing the signing keys for the Tallgrove upstream API circuit breaker, confirm the support team can force the breaker open during a full outage. The override bundle lives in the sealed escrow drawer and is useless without its unlock phrase. Two ceremony witnesses must initial this step before proceeding. The escrow bundle is decrypted with the recovery passphrase that follows.

vault phrase of kahip-kahop = holath-quenmir

The Corvessa payments gateway detected retry requests from third-party plugins arriving without idempotency keys. Without a key, an automatic retry after a network timeout can create a duplicate charge, which our reconciliation job cannot safely reverse. All plugin authors must generate a unique key per logical payment attempt and reuse it across retries of that attempt. This alert fires whenever keyless retries exceed the hourly threshold. Key generation rules and example flows are documented on the internal page below.

operations page: https://jira.zemvarlabs.internal/browse/pages/pages/projects

**Ticket: Expired credentials blocking font vendoring**

The nightly job that vendors third-party fonts into the Marrowtype asset bundle is failing because its credentials to the Glyphhaven artifact proxy expired on Tuesday. Until rotation automation lands, support should update the job's secret manually after each expiry. A fresh key for the proxy has been issued and is included below.

gateway credential: qvz11-0UzFBR2ZJRm